first, when you joined the forum, you had to give your e-mail address as a verifcation tool. I have NEVER seen anyone's e-mail address from this forum unless they sent me an e-mail message, or

second, I have seen a few people use what looks to be an e-mail address as their handle. That seems less than best practices.

third, some people have posted their actual e-mail addrress in the middle of a post. Spamming bots can pick that up pretty easy I would imagine. The more usual way to "post" your e-mail address (if you feel you just HAVE to) would be similar to "address at company dot com". But even that is unnecessary. Just tell people to contact you via PM (personal message) or to send you an e-mail through the forum functions.

Ditto on publishing your home or office or cell phone number on an open forum. If you think someone might need your phone number, tell them to PM you. Then only you and them, instead of the entire world, can see the message.

Another ditto. Visitor messages can be seen by anyone that takes the time to "enroll" in the forum. Don't put anything in a visitor message that you don't want the whole world to see.

Finally, I am NOT a forum administrator, nor am I all that computer / forum knowledgeable. But common sense and risk assessment should suggest to everyone that using a handle other than their real name or e-mail address is the sensible thing to do.

One thing to check under your UserCP is that you have not enabled the "Allow vCard Download" option. The default (at least when I regestered) is that this function is not active, but to be sure, click on "UserCP" at the top of the forum, then click on "Edit Options" under "Settings and Options" in the sidebar on the left. If there is a check in the box next to "Allow vCard Download", then remove that check and click on "Save changes" at the bottom of that page.
